"textContent": "A new study led by researchers at Moffitt Cancer Center found that blood-based DNA markers known as protein epiScores can help predict which colorectal cancer patients face a higher risk of cancer recurrence or death. Results of the study were published in Clinical Epigenetics.",
"title": "Q&A: Simple blood test may help identify colorectal cancer patients at higher risk for recurrence and death"
